I've always received paper checks sent to my home when I had cash available. I've had checks sent dozens of times. Now that I have a decent amount due the system will not link me to the check request page. It routes you to a page that requests you link to a bank account. I've contacted their "help chat" several times and all any of them know how to do is cut and paste instructions on how to link your bank account. Oh, and they also always say "your address cannot be verified". I might say they are lying but I believe they are most likely just strictly following the instructions that they are told. I supposedly got linked to a "supervisor" (Venilla) who seemed helpful. This person told me there was absolutely nothing wrong with my account or address and that I'm properly set up to have checks sent to me. That was verified on their end. They added "it's definitely a technical issue on their end and that they are working to fix it". When I followed up, it has not been fixed AND the cut and paste of "link to a bank account and address verification" was sent to me via chat. This is a pretty serious issue if they are intentionally blocking people from getting their money. Anyone else having this issue currently?
